You can also assign a project to yourself, which will<br />
give you the following advantages:<br />
v Project activity guide<br />
v Step-by-step tutorial movies that walk you through the project<br />
v Copy of the completed project<br />
v All the resources needed to recreate<br />
the example project<br />
v Assessment rubric<br />
The system will keep track of where you are up to, so that the next time you log in, you can continue<br />
where you previously stopped. You can even set a due date for yourself to finish all the training for the<br />
particular application. Once the project is complete, you can compare it with the solution file.<br />
